What is a line position in a job?

A line position, such as a Line Associate role, involves performing specific tasks on a production line or assembly line in a manufacturing or retail environment. It typically requires teamwork, attention to detail, and the ability to follow safety protocols and standard operating procedures. These roles often involve standing for long periods and working in shifts.

What are some common challenges faced by Line Associates in a manufacturing environment, and how can they be addressed?

Line Associates often encounter challenges such as maintaining consistent speed and quality during repetitive tasks, adapting to changes in production schedules, and ensuring safety in a fast-paced environment. These can be addressed through thorough onboarding, clear communication with supervisors, and ongoing training on equipment and safety protocols. Collaborating with team members and staying attentive to workflow adjustments can also help Line Associates adapt more easily and maintain productivity.

What is the difference between Line Associate vs Machine Operator?

AspectLine AssociateMachine Operator
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; on-the-job trainingHigh school diploma or equivalent; technical certification often preferred
Work EnvironmentManufacturing or production line, fast-pacedManufacturing, operating specific machinery
Industry UsageCommon in retail, food production, manufacturingPrimarily in manufacturing, industrial settings
Job FocusAssisting in assembly, packaging, or quality checksOperating and maintaining machinery

While both roles are integral to manufacturing and production environments, a Line Associate typically supports assembly and packaging tasks, whereas a Machine Operator specializes in operating specific machinery. The roles often overlap in work environment and required credentials, but Machine Operators usually require technical skills related to machinery operation.

What are Line Associates?

Line Associates are workers who perform tasks on a production or assembly line in factories or manufacturing plants. Their responsibilities typically include assembling products, inspecting items for quality, packaging goods, and ensuring that production targets and safety standards are met. Line Associates often work as part of a team, following specific instructions and processes to keep the production line running smoothly. This job usually requires attention to detail, manual dexterity, and the ability to stand for extended periods. Training is often provided on the job, and positions may be entry-level or require prior manufacturing experience.

Position Overview

At CarMax, all new managers complete a structured four-month training program to ensure they are prepared to succeed in their new role. The Front-Line Manager in Training is a training and development program designed to give a new CarMax manager the tools they need to assume the role of a Front-Line Manager within the Service Operations department. All Front-Line Managers in Training must successfully complete the training program before taking on the role of a Front-Line Manager.

Training includes learning the following:

· Roles and responsibilities of functional areas within Service Operations

· End-to-end production process including inventory management, cosmetic and mechanical repair

· Fundamental management skills of leaders at CarMax through our Management Development Program

Upon successful completion of the Front-Line Manager in Training Program, the new Manager will be placed in one of the following roles: Flow Mechanical Manager, Flow Cosmetic Manager, Flow Supply Manager, Inventory Manager, or Service Manager.
